The MA in International Relations at the University of Portsmouth is a comprehensive program designed for those interested in understanding contemporary global issues. Offered via distance learning, this Master's degree can be pursued full-time over one year or part-time over two years, allowing flexibility for working professionals or military personnel. The curriculum covers critical topics such as national security, terrorism, and the impact of social movements, equipping students with analytical skills to assess global conflicts and policies. Students engage with core modules like 'Exploring International Relations' and 'Contemporary Security in International Relations,' alongside optional modules that allow for specialization in areas such as NGOs, social movements, and European international relations. The program emphasizes independent study, supported by interactive online seminars and access to extensive digital resources. Graduates are well-prepared for careers in international organizations, government, and NGOs, contributing positively to global security and development.
